如何使用Python生成xlsx文件
1. 整体流程
下面是生成xlsx文件的整体流程:
sequenceDiagram
participant 开发者
participant 小白
开发者->>小白: 解释生成xlsx文件的流程
开发者->>小白: 提供代码和示例
小白->>开发者: 提问和请求帮助
开发者->>小白: 提供进一步解释和指导
小白->>开发者: 学习和实践代码
小白->>开发者: 反馈结果和问题
开发者->>小白: 给予反馈和解决问题
小白->>开发者: 最终实现生成xlsx文件
2. 详细步骤
下面是每个步骤的具体内容,包括所需代码和注释:
步骤1:导入所需库
首先,我们需要导入openpyxl库,它是一个用于操作xlsx文件的强大工具。
import openpyxl
步骤2:创建工作簿和工作表
要生成xlsx文件,我们首先需要创建一个工作簿和一个工作表。
# 创建工作簿
workbook = openpyxl.Workbook()
# 选择默认的工作表
sheet = workbook.active
步骤3:写入数据
要在xlsx文件中写入数据,我们需要选择要写入的单元格,并将数据赋值给它。
# 选择要写入的单元格
cell = sheet['A1']
# 给单元格赋值
cell.value = 'Hello, World!'
步骤4:保存文件
最后,我们需要将工作簿保存为xlsx文件。
# 保存文件
workbook.save('example.xlsx')
3. 示例代码
下面是完整的示例代码:
import openpyxl
# 创建工作簿
workbook = openpyxl.Workbook()
# 选择默认的工作表
sheet = workbook.active
# 选择要写入的单元格
cell = sheet['A1']
# 给单元格赋值
cell.value = 'Hello, World!'
# 保存文件
workbook.save('example.xlsx')
4. 总结
通过以上步骤,我们可以轻松地使用Python生成xlsx文件。首先,我们导入openpyxl库;然后,创建工作簿和工作表;接着,选择要写入的单元格并赋值;最后,保存工作簿为xlsx文件。对于刚入行的开发者来说,这是一个非常基础且实用的技能。希望这篇文章对你有所帮助!